Re: Enough FAE [Re: littleapplemm]
    #9858446 -

To me it sounds like you should be far more worried about your humidity at this point than your FAE.

Humidity is the #1 factor for growing mushrooms.  FAE is maybe #2, but if you have enough holes that your humidity is going down, you are getting lots of FAE, get it?

Focus on fanning at the pinning stage - fanning is the key factor in promoting little babies to form.  Once theyve formed, switch to focusing heavily on providing enough moisture for them to grow.

Re: Enough FAE [Re: littleapplemm]
    #9858536 -

I mean....

Both.  I dont know the specifics (search some of RogerRabits posts for this) but mushrooms need something like 90% or higher humidity to grow.  If you drop below that, FAE isnt doing you any good - nothings gonna grow.

On the other hand - if you just put your cakes in a tub full of wet perlite with no holes and never fan it - youre sitting at 99 or 100% humidity but also nothing is gonna grow.

There is a happy medium that isnt too hard to find.

But yea, FAE and light are most important at the pinning stage.  I saw a post the other day saying that exposing a substrate (that was pinning poorly) to some sunlight for a few minutes triggered an explosion of pins.  Just a thought.

Re: Enough FAE [Re: Premedman1]
    #9859033 -

Get some more perlite in there.  You want five inches or so.  However, humidity isn't the MOST important thing.  Air exchange is.  You can easily mist to make up for lost moisture, but without proper fresh air, there won't be any moisture loss from the substrate, which just happens to be the number 1 pinning trigger.  Fan whenever you think of it, but the shotgun terrarium will take care of itself when you're at work or whatever.  Simply mist to make up for moisture that evaporates from the substrate, and the over-spray will re-moisten the perlite at the same time.
